Interim HSE Manager – Rail Industry - Salary - Up to £40K (pro rata) depending on experience | Temporary (4-month fixed-term contract)
We are proud to be working exclusively with a pioneering force in the UK rail industry, specialising in the ad-hoc movement of rolling stock, locomotive spot hire, and charter train operations.
They are currently recruiting for an Interim HSE Manager (4-month fixed-term contract).
Headquartered in Derby, our client is at the forefront of modernising UK rail with the launch of the country’s most advanced tri-mode locomotives. These next-generation locomotives incorporate revolutionary technology designed to deliver sustainable, flexible, and highly efficient rail transport solutions.

Our client is seeking a Temporary HSE Manager to join their Derby-based team on a 4-month contract. This is a key role supporting the Head of Safety in maintaining compliance with health, safety, and environmental legislation, risk management, reporting, and driving continuous improvement.
Key Responsibilities:
Support the Head of Safety in delivering HSE objectives across the organisation
Maintain and regularly update the Register of Legislation to ensure legal compliance
Manage statutory reporting of accidents and incidents to authorities such as SMIS, RAIB, and ORR
Assist in compiling internal and external reports and analysing accident and incident data
Maintain the company’s business risk profile, offering recommendations to reduce operational risks
Monitor and assess legislative updates, industry standards, and best practices for their impact on operations
Ensure the company’s Safety Certificate and supporting documentation remain compliant and up to date
Support or lead investigations into safety incidents, ensuring a thorough and effective process
Participate in internal and external audit programmes
About You:
Educated to GCSE level (or equivalent) in Mathematics, English, and Science
NEBOSH General Certificate (or equivalent health and safety qualification)
Excellent analytical skills, with the ability to interpret data and identify trends
Strong communication and interpersonal skills, capable of working with regulators and senior stakeholders
Experience working in a safety-critical environment, ideally within the rail or transport sectors
Confident in contributing to internal audits, compliance processes, and continuous improvement initiatives
